Characterization of zeolitic imidazole framework (ZIF-8) catalyst for potential biodiesel production from waste cooking oil (WCO)
Heteropoly acids (HPAs) catalysts prove effective in waste cooking oil biodiesel production, considering their high density of Brønsted acidic sites, exhibit significant resilience to elevated levels of free fatty acid (FFA) and moisture content.
